The Sacramento Kings go up against the Phoenix Suns at PHX Arena on Wednesday, October 22, 2025. The game, the first of the 2025-26 season for both teams, begins at 10 p.m. ET on AZFamily, Suns+, and NBCS-CA.
The Suns are just a 1.5-point favorite when they and the Kings square off in a game oddsmakers expect to be a close matchup. The matchup’s over/under is set at 228.5.
